The STC12C5205AD35ILQFP32G is a robust and versatile microcontroller designed by STMicroelectronics, a leader in the semiconductor industry. This microcontroller is part of the STC12C family, which is renowned for its high performance, reliability, and ease of use in embedded systems. The device is particularly suitable for industrial applications, consumer electronics, and automotive systems due to its wide range of features and capabilities.
At the heart of the STC12C5205AD35ILQFP32G is a high-speed 8051-compatible CPU core, which operates at up to 35MHz. This provides the computational power necessary to handle complex tasks and algorithms efficiently. The microcontroller is equipped with 5KB of Flash program memory, which is ample space for storing firmware and applications. It also includes 256 bytes of RAM, ensuring smooth operation and data processing.
The device comes in a space-saving 32-pin LQFP (Low-profile Quad Flat Package) that is suitable for space-constrained applications. The package is designed for surface-mount technology (SMT), which allows for a more compact and reliable PCB design.
Among its key features, the STC12C5205AD35ILQFP32G offers a wide range of peripherals and interfaces. It includes multiple 16-bit timers/counters, a full-duplex UART for serial communication, and an SPI (Serial Peripheral Interface) for high-speed data transfers. Additionally, it has an array of I/O ports for connecting to other components and devices within a system.
The microcontroller supports a wide operating voltage range from 2.7V to 5.5V, making it adaptable to various power supply conditions. It also boasts a comprehensive set of power-saving modes, which are crucial for battery-powered or energy-sensitive applications.
The STC12C5205AD35ILQFP32G is designed with reliability in mind, featuring a built-in watchdog timer to prevent system failures and ensure continuous operation. It also includes brown-out detection and power-on reset capabilities to enhance system stability under fluctuating power conditions.
In conclusion, the STC12C5205AD35ILQFP32G from STMicroelectronics is a powerful and efficient microcontroller that offers a perfect blend of performance, integration, and reliability for a wide array of applications. Its rich set of features and compact form factor make it an excellent choice for designers looking to create sophisticated and reliable embedded systems.